MySQL quitting, restarts only after hard reboot

2003-02-19 Thread Bill Leonard
This one is still biting us.. any suggestions on where to troubleshoot 
would be appreciated.

Mac OS X Server, 10.2.1 - MySQL 3.23.51

Heavy usage, but no more than 50 open connections at a time

Occasionally, MySQL just quits serving databases. The first indication 
is a forum or something comes up with a could not connect to database 
message.

Logging in to MySQL via the command line works, but a show databases 
command shows an empty set.

The error log in /var/mysql doesn't show anything helpful, only the 
last time it was started.

Re-starting mysqld from the command line doesn't work.

Only rebooting the machine seems to work, but clearly, there must be 
something I don't understand.

What could be going on that it exhibits this behavior? Any ideas?
